import 'package:flutter/material.dart';
import 'package:go_router/go_router.dart';
final GlobalKey<NavigatorState> _rootNavigatorKey =
GlobalKey<NavigatorState>(debugLabel: 'root');
final GlobalKey<NavigatorState> _shellNavigatorKey =
GlobalKey<NavigatorState>(debugLabel: 'shell');
// This scenario demonstrates how to set up nested navigation using ShellRoute,
// which is a pattern where an additional Navigator is placed in the widget tree
// to be used instead of the root navigator. This allows deep-links to display
// pages along with other UI components such as a BottomNavigationBar.
//
// This example demonstrates how to display a route within a ShellRoute and also
// push a screen using a different navigator (such as the root Navigator) by
// providing a `parentNavigatorKey`.
void main() {
runApp(ShellRouteExampleApp());
}
/// An example demonstrating how to use [ShellRoute]
class ShellRouteExampleApp extends StatelessWidget {
/// Creates a [ShellRouteExampleApp]
ShellRouteExampleApp({Key? key}) : super(key: key);
final GoRouter _router = GoRouter(
navigatorKey: _rootNavigatorKey,
initialLocation: '/a',
routes: <RouteBase>[
/// Application shell
ShellRoute(
navigatorKey: _shellNavigatorKey,
builder: (BuildContext context, GoRouterState state, Widget child) {
return ScaffoldWithNavBar(child: child);
},
routes: <RouteBase>[
/// The first screen to display in the bottom navigation bar.
GoRoute(
path: '/a',
builder: (BuildContext context, GoRouterState state) {
return const ScreenA();
},
routes: <RouteBase>[
// The details screen to display stacked on the inner Navigator.
// This will cover screen A but not the application shell.
GoRoute(
path: 'details',
builder: (BuildContext context, GoRouterState state) {
return const DetailsScreen(label: 'A');
},
),
],
),
/// Displayed when the second item in the the bottom navigation bar is
/// selected.
GoRoute(
path: '/b',
builder: (BuildContext context, GoRouterState state) {
return const ScreenB();
},
routes: <RouteBase>[
/// Same as "/a/details", but displayed on the root Navigator by
/// specifying [parentNavigatorKey]. This will cover both screen B
/// and the application shell.
GoRoute(
path: 'details',
parentNavigatorKey: _rootNavigatorKey,
builder: (BuildContext context, GoRouterState state) {
return const DetailsScreen(label: 'B');
},
),
],
),
/// The third screen to display in the bottom navigation bar.
GoRoute(
path: '/c',
builder: (BuildContext context, GoRouterState state) {
return const ScreenC();
},
routes: <RouteBase>[
// The details screen to display stacked on the inner Navigator.
// This will cover screen A but not the application shell.
GoRoute(
path: 'details',
builder: (BuildContext context, GoRouterState state) {
return const DetailsScreen(label: 'C');
},
),
],
),
],
),
],
);
@override
Widget build(BuildContext context) {
return MaterialApp.router(
title: 'Flutter Demo',
theme: ThemeData(
primarySwatch: Colors.blue,
),
routerConfig: _router,
);
}
}
/// Builds the "shell" for the app by building a Scaffold with a
/// BottomNavigationBar, where [child] is placed in the body of the Scaffold.
class ScaffoldWithNavBar extends StatelessWidget {
/// Constructs an [ScaffoldWithNavBar].
const ScaffoldWithNavBar({
required this.child,
Key? key,
}) : super(key: key);
/// The widget to display in the body of the Scaffold.
/// In this sample, it is a Navigator.
final Widget child;
@override
Widget build(BuildContext context) {
return Scaffold(
body: child,
bottomNavigationBar: BottomNavigationBar(
items: const <BottomNavigationBarItem>[
BottomNavigationBarItem(
icon: Icon(Icons.home),
label: 'A Screen',
),
BottomNavigationBarItem(
icon: Icon(Icons.business),
label: 'B Screen',
),
BottomNavigationBarItem(
icon: Icon(Icons.notification_important_rounded),
label: 'C Screen',
),
],
currentIndex: _calculateSelectedIndex(context),
onTap: (int idx) => _onItemTapped(idx, context),
),
);
}
static int _calculateSelectedIndex(BuildContext context) {
final GoRouter route = GoRouter.of(context);
final String location = route.location;
if (location.startsWith('/a')) {
return 0;
}
if (location.startsWith('/b')) {
return 1;
}
if (location.startsWith('/c')) {
return 2;
}
return 0;
}
void _onItemTapped(int index, BuildContext context) {
switch (index) {
case 0:
GoRouter.of(context).go('/a');
break;
case 1:
GoRouter.of(context).go('/b');
break;
case 2:
GoRouter.of(context).go('/c');
break;
}
}
}
